Concord Corp., a leader in the commercial cleaning industry, acquired and installed, at a total cost of $104,500 plus 15% HST, three underground tanks to store hazardous liquid solutions needed in the cleaning process. The tanks were ready for use on February 28, 2020. The provincial ministry of the environment regulates the use of such tanks and requires them to be disposed of after 10 years of use. Concord estimates that the cost of digging up and removing the tanks in 2030 will be $25,360. An appropriate interest or discount rate is 6%. Concord also manufactures commercial cleaning machines that it sells to dry cleaning establishments throughout Nova Scotia. During 2020, Concord sold 20 machines at a price of $13,140 each plus 15% HST. The machines were sold with a two-year warranty for parts and labour. Similar warranty agreements are available separately and are estimated to have a stand-alone value of $885. Sales in 2020 occurred evenly throughout the year. Any revenue related to the warranty agreements is assumed to be earned evenly over the two-year contract term as follows: 2020, 25%, 2021, 50%, and 2022, 25%. Concord estimates the total cost of servicing the warranties will be $10,430 over the two-year contract term. Concord incurred actual warranty expenditures of $2,571 in 2020. Answer the following, assuming Concord follows IFRS and has a December 31 fiscal year end. Click here to view the factor table PRESENT VALUE OF 1. Click here to view the factor table PRESENT VALUE OF AN ANNUITY OF 1. Assuming straight-line depreciation and no residual value for the tanks at the end of their 10-year useful life, what is the balance in the asset Storage Tanks account, net of accumulated depreciation, at December 31, 2020?
